Bolivia 2 project

Developing multidisciplinary care

Partner institution
Asociación Cochabambina de Hemofilia

Represented by
Prof José Luis Quino Caballero, President


Duration
2.5 years, envisaged start Q1 2020

Status
Execution

Objectives

  • Increase awareness about haemophilia amongst the general public and foster support from authorities
  • Improve haemophilia knowledge and referral system for first-contact healthcare professionals in the rural regions of the country
  • Develop haemophilia multidisciplinary care team in Cochabamba
  • Empower 100 people with haemophilia and family members on self-infusion
  • Empower patient organisations from Bolivia, Peru, Paraguay and Ecuador
  • Strengthen laboratory in the Valle region and develop diagnosis access across the country
